Compare all specifications:
1994 Ferrari 512 TR | 1976 Fiat 130 | |
Make | Ferrari | Fiat |
Model | 512 TR | 130 |
Year Released | 1994 | 1976 |
Engine Position | Middle | Front |
Engine Size | 4943 cc | 3238 cc |
Horse Power | 423 HP | 163 HP |
Engine RPM | 6750 RPM | 5600 RPM |
Torque | 501 Nm | 255 Nm |
Torque RPM | 5500 RPM | 3400 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 82 mm | 102 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 78 mm | 66 mm |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 2 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 2 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1570 kg | 1570 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4490 mm | 4760 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1980 mm | 1820 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1140 mm | 1450 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2560 mm | 2730 mm |
